Prevalence of GJB2 mutations and the del(GJB6-D13S1830) in Argentinean non-syndromic deaf patients.
Hearing research - 1 Sept 2005
Dalamón Viviana, Béhèran Agustina, Diamante Fernando, Pallares Norma, Diamante Vicente, Elgoyhen Ana Belén
Abstract excerpt
Genetically caused congenital deafness is a common trait affecting 1 in 2000 children and it is predominantly inherited in an autosomal recessive fashion. Several mutations in the GJB2 gene and a deletion of 342 kb in GJB6 (delGJB6-D13S1830) have been identified worldwide in patients with hearing impairment. The aim of this study was to determine the prevalence of these mutations in Argentina. Non-syndromic 46...
